Responsibility
- Plan and monitor safe passage for all assigned voyages, including route selection, weather risk assessment, and contingency planning.
- Operate ECDIS, ARPA radar, AIS, and automated watchkeeping systems to maintain situational awareness.
- Maintain bridge watch and ensure compliance with COLREGs, SOLAS, and company safety policies.
- Coordinate with port authorities, pilots, and vessel traffic services to secure smooth arrivals and departures.
- Conduct navigational risk assessments and implement mitigations for adverse weather or restricted waters.
- Lead and mentor junior officers; deliver targeted training and drills on navigation procedures.
- Prepare and review voyage plans, weather routing, and post-voyage reports for performance optimization.
- Ensure accurate logbooks, bridge procedures, and documentation for audits and inspections.
